Cairo - MENA

Prime Minister Ibrahim Mahlab has vowed taking legal actions against hospitals and health centers the do not adhere to the decision of providing the medical emergency services free of charge for 48 hours.
Citizens who want to make a complaint against medical facilities that do not abide by the decision can contact the Cabinet's Information and Decision Support Center (IDSC), and it would take the appropriate legal actions.
The government pays the health expenses of those cases, so all health care facilities must abide by the decision, the premier added.
